Their Roles and Responsibilities
The role of a weekend news anchor is more than just reading headlines. These guys are responsible for shaping the narrative, providing context, and ensuring the accuracy of the information presented. Weekend anchors often work with smaller teams and have to be incredibly versatile. They might be involved in writing scripts, editing video, and even conducting interviews. They need to be quick on their feet and able to handle breaking news situations with composure and professionalism. A key part of their job is to connect with the audience. They need to be relatable, trustworthy, and able to communicate complex information in a clear and concise manner. This involves having strong communication skills, a deep understanding of current events, and the ability to think critically under pressure. Furthermore, weekend anchors often serve as the face of the news station in the community, attending events, and engaging with viewers on social media. They must be active listeners, responding to viewer feedback and addressing concerns in a timely and respectful manner. This level of engagement helps build trust and strengthens the relationship between the news station and the community it serves. Behind the Scenes
Ever wondered what goes on behind the scenes at KCAL 9? It's not all glamour and bright lights! These anchors work long hours, often starting their day well before the sun comes up. They collaborate with a team of producers, reporters, and editors to put together a seamless and informative newscast. The process of creating a single newscast involves countless hours of research, writing, and editing. Reporters are out in the field gathering information, conducting interviews, and capturing footage, while producers are working to organize and structure the newscast. Editors are responsible for assembling the video and audio components into a cohesive and engaging story. The anchors play a crucial role in bringing all of these elements together, weaving together the various stories into a cohesive and informative narrative. They work closely with the production team to ensure that the newscast is accurate, timely, and relevant to the viewers. Moreover, the behind-the-scenes work extends beyond the studio. Anchors and reporters are constantly monitoring news wires, social media, and other sources of information to stay up-to-date on the latest developments. They are also involved in community outreach efforts, attending events and engaging with viewers to build relationships and foster trust. This level of engagement helps the news station stay connected to the community and ensures that its coverage is reflective of the needs and interests of its viewers. In addition to the journalistic aspects of the job, there are also the technical considerations. Anchors must be comfortable working with cameras, microphones, and other broadcast equipment. They must also be able to handle the pressures of live television, responding to unexpected events and maintaining their composure under pressure. The ability to remain calm and collected in the face of adversity is essential for ensuring that the newscast runs smoothly and that viewers receive accurate and reliable information.
